Re: Hobbylobby Jetiger
I have a Jettiger. It's an Art-Tech plane. It flies pretty good. It needs a little bit of reflex, and a good hard launch. Mine is not quite as fast as expected, maybe mine is a Friday Job or something. I don't really feel like playing with it, I'm giving it to a buddy who is more interested in it.
The plane was as advertized, but performance was not as expected. Maybe 65mph, similar to many scale 64mm edfs. But...if you wanted to hot it up, put in a better motor and what not this plane would be a great test bed... |
